Matthias Schwarz
2003/12/20

Puppet Master - The Legacy is basically a clip show of the previous movies which came before, so if you have seem them, you can skip this and don't miss anything new, except maybe 5-10 minutes of two people talking in a cellar. Everything else is really just one big lazy as can get clip show so many series and sitcoms are doing to fill an episode to save money.But even if you haven't seen the previous movies, I wouldn't recommend it. Because it is not doing a too good job retelling the story. Thought it at least tries to gather the loose threads and tries to explain a few plot holes. I think it only points them out even more so. I actually stopped watching the films after this, and I liked the first three or five, they weren't very good, but charming and had some good stop motion animation, but they were getting worse, and this one is really one of the worst and laziest movies I ever saw. The charm and puppeteering art of the Puppet Master movies is not to be found in "The Legacy".

skybrick736
2003/12/22

The problem with Legacy isn't the fact that it the majority of it shows all the past movies with a very small subplot. The problem is that it was horribly edited and with a better storyline could have meshed the current situation with Peter and the previous story lines so much better. I'm actually kind of a fan of the idea to playback all the memories but the wrong scenes were shown and it didn't flow. It's not a good movie at all, the eighty percent of old scenes were boring and the new twenty percent were highlighted with a couple of horrible acting and more questions than answers. The lady agent is just horrendous and her story is completely far-fetched and laughable. I'd stay away from the movie or else just fast forward through the past events and check out the terribly cheesy plot that comes in and trickles out every so often. Since this is chronologically the last movie in the series I'm looking forward to the possibility of a franchise rejuvenation in the near future.
